Dog collars come in many shapes, sizes and colors. Each tends to depict the owners, as well as the dogs personality. The history of dog collars dates back to ancient Egypt. While it is well known Egyptians maintained felines as pets their canine counterparts are more widely depicted as hunters, protectors, and various gods and symbols. During this time frame, dog collars were widely utilized in training and were often decorated with various symbols and verbiage. Many farm dog collars were embedded with nails and studs as protection from potential wolf attacks while protecting a flock. Padlock dog collars became popular during the renaissance age as this was often used to signal ownership since there was only one key. Today, dog collars continue to be used for a multitude of purposes such as control and identification. However, as our pets become more pampered, designer dog collars become more decorative. Everything from diamonds, silver, baubles, flamboyant colors and materials are available on today’s market.

You’re stranded. Far away from your family, job, and everything in your life. Every day is a struggle to survive. Whether you’re looking for food, hiding from polar bears, or traveling through time there is always something strange going on at their new home. This is the whole concept behind the show “Lost.” Wonderfully written and acted, the viewers never know what to expect during their next trip to the mysterious island. Throughout the past seasons, “Lost” has faced various changes which keep viewers guessing what format the show will take in the next season. There have been flash-backs, flash-forwards, and time travel. In addition to the non-linear format of the show, various characters weave in and out of the show. Viewers are not forced to continue seeing the same story arcs with the same few characters, rather new stories are intertwined with old. The series began with a plan crash, causing survivors of the Oceanic flight to be stranded on an island. Since that first episode, viewers have been guessing what the final outcome of the show will be. For this reason, viewers have remained entertained and interested throughout the entirety of its airing, causing it to be one of the best shows on Television.
